About this listen

Secrets lie at the bottom of North Tenmile Lake, Oregon.

Ian Kelly rents a cottage on the water to pull him and Samantha away from the heat. Now, he's hearing rumors that his landlord, Walter Ponce, may have chained a man to the riverbed.

That's alright because Ian is sure Walter Ponce has heard some rumors too about a mysterious family involved in a gangland shootout only months ago.

Still, Oregon should have been a nice place for Ian to retire if the CIA didn't come knocking. And with them, a young assassin who botched a job in the city. Needs to lay low with Ian. Sure, if it means Ian can stay off the books for a while.

But Ian's employers aren't the only ones who followed his trail north.

Plunge into an experience brimming with three-dimensional characters, each with real-world problems (and secrets). What you get is an assassin thriller that's as much about living as it is about killing. And an adventure that's as deeply unsettling as it is utterly addictive.
